  • 5/5 Dallas M. 1 month ago on Google • 359 reviews New
    Words cannot describe the feeling you'll experience here. If you've read any of my reviews, you'll know how robust they are; however, I am keeping this one short. Words of advise, you need to experience the show to at least 2-3 different songs. This is such an iconic place to visit while you're in Las Vegas, therefore, it doesn't matter what anyone says about it, you need to go visit for yourself. According to the Bellagio website, here's the water show schedule as of February 26, 2024: Monday - Friday: Every 30 minutes from 3:00 PM to 6:30 PM and every 15 minutes from 7:00 PM to midnight Saturday, Sunday, & Holidays: Every 30 minutes from noon to 6:30 PM and every 15 minutes from 7:00 PM to midnight

  • 5/5 Adriana P. 7 months ago on Google
    Definitely a highlight in Las Vegas. The show plays Mon - Fri 3pm - 6:30 every half hour; 7pm - 12am every 15 minutes. Sat - Sun 12pm - 6:30pm every half hour; 7pm - 12am every 15 minutes. It's free, it's entertaining and definitely pretty. And they do have different songs throughout the day.
